Ghost Reveal ‘Infestissumam’ Album Release Plans

Metal Blade Records Swedish metal outfit  Ghost have been pounding away in the studio, working to complete their latest effort and the band is happy to announce that ‘Infestissumam’ will arrive next spring. The follow-up to the critically hailed ‘Opus Eponymous’ album was produced by Nick Raskulinecz (Foo Fighters, Deftones, Death Angel) and will be released by Loma Vista Recordings. The 10-track set features the song ‘Secular Haze,’ which the band debuted live during their performance in Linkoping, Sweden over the weekend. Video from the show can be seen below. ‘Secular Haze’ is also available as a free download at the band’s website .
